The Dayton Audio® Wave-Link™ WLS Wireless Transmitter/Receiver System eliminates the need for bulky cables in your home theater system. With a versatile audio transmitter, the Wave-Link™ feeds a wireless signal from a source such as a TV or A/V receiver to powered speakers, powered subwoofers, powered surround speakers, and second-zone speakers. In addition, you can stream TV audio to amplifiers and receivers wirelessly. The WLS wireless system solves wiring dilemmas quickly and easily. Place your powered subwoofer, powered speaker, or amplifier in the location that provides optimal sound without worrying about a cable. Stream wireless audio from the WLS transmitter to the WLS receiver. A built-in DAC allows you to plug the transmitter directly into any computer’s USB port and stream digital audio directly to the receiver. A handy button on the transmitter acts as a source selector switch so you can easily toggle between an analog or digital input. Use the Wave-Link™ WLS to add powered speakers or passive speakers running off a local amplifier to your patio, pool area, or anywhere you’d like to enjoy music away from your primary A/V system. Connect the Wave-Link™ to your PC, TV, or streaming media player and send a signal to any stereo in the house. Please note the transmitter and receiver require AC or USB outlets for power.

The Insignia 3.5 mm to Bluetooth Audio Adapter is a unique adapter both transmits and receives signals, which means the same accessory that lets you play music from your phone to your car stereo can also send the audio from the airplane movie to your wireless headphones. And you no longer have to share headphones to watch the in-flight entertainment—transmit mode can pair with multiple devices, allowing you to sync up both sets of headphones.

The Scapade™ AirPro is a compact Bluetooth® transmitter that transmits audio to 2 sets of headphones so they can share the same audio source. Plug the 3.5-mm entertainment adapter into an airplane entertainment system or a gym TV and enjoy wire-free listening with a friend. Equipped with TX (transmitter) and RX (receiver) modes, it adapts to various scenarios from airplanes to cars, boats, and home stereos. Low-latency performance helps keep sound in sync, and the rechargeable design is ready for every trip. It is the ideal travel companion for flights, road trips, workouts, or home use - it keeps your audio wireless, reliable, and shareable.
